How Does Science Help To Solve Crimes?

How Does Science Help To Solve Crimes? During the forensic science process, forensic equipment is used to process samples and evidence to solve crimes. Measurements include analysis of evidence, fingerprinting or DNA identification, analysing drugs or chemicals, and dealing with body fluids. What science is used to solve crimes? What Databases Do The Police Use?

What Databases Do The Police Use? RAID is a multi-user Relational Database Management System (RDBMS) used by NDIC as well as other intelligence and law enforcement agencies.
